Brief Overview of Solar
PV Technology
Solar cells are made ofsilicon(microelectronics/semiconductors)Treated to be positive on one side and negative on theother.When light energy hits the cell, electrons are knocked loosefrom the atoms in the semiconductor material.If electrical conductors are attached to the positive andnegative sides, forming an electrical circuit, the electronscan be captured in the form of an electric

Every single photovoltaic cell has smalldimensions and generally produces a powerbetween 1 and 3 watts and 0,5Volts, at thestandard test conditions (STC) of 1000W/m.
To get a bigger power and voltage, it isnecessary to connect several cells among
themselves to create bigger units calledmodules

Some benefits of
photovoltaicsNo fuel requirements - In remote areas diesel
or kerosene fuel supplies are erratic and oftenvery expensive
Modular design - A solar array comprisesindividual PV modules, which can beconnected to meet a particular demand.
Reliability of PV modules - This has beenshown to be significantly higher than that ofdiesel generators.
8/14/2019 APPLICATION OF SOLAR PVS IN INDIA
10/45
Easy to maintain - Operation and routinemaintenance requirements are simple
Long life - With no moving parts and alldelicate surfaces protected, modules can beexpected to provide power for 15 years ormore.
Environmentally benign - There is no pollutionthrough the use of a PV system nor is thereany heat or noise generated which couldcause local discomfort

Solar lanterns :A recent innovation in solartechnology is the solar lantern. Originallydesigned for the outdoor leisure market inwestern countries, this simple lantern with asmall PV module (5 -10 watts) is extremelyappropriate to use in rural areas of developingcountries for replacing kerosene lamps. Cost
is still a barrier, as is the potential for localmanufacture, but there is enormous scope forwidespread dissemination of a simple, robustsolar lantern.

A total of 32 grid interactive solar PV powerplants have been installed in the country withfinancial assistance from the Federal
Government
These plants, with aggregate capacity of 2.1MW, are estimated to generate about 2.52million units of electricity in a year
For rural electrification as well as employmentand income generation, about 16,530 solarphotovoltaic lighting systems were installed
during 2004-05

minigrids in
SunderbansNine SPV mini-grids with a cumulative
installed capacity of 344.5 kWp have beeninstalled by WBREDA in Sunderbans
Each of the 1,750 consumers, who typicallywould have used kerosene for lighting anddiesel- based battery charging for TV viewing,has the potential of saving 228.2 kg CO2emissions annually, as per a study conductedin the year 2000

Kaveri Agri-Care Pvt.
Ltd., IndiaThe plant specializes in drying coir peat,which is a fine granular material extractedfrom underneath the coconut skin.
The final product is extremely absorbent andbuoyant,making it ideal for usage in soilreplacement and oil spills
It was important to have a drying process thatwould be cost effective, that would not addfurther pollution to the local environment, andthat would not adversely harm the coir peat.
8/14/2019 APPLICATION OF SOLAR PVS IN INDIA
37/45
It was determined that SolarWall technologywould provide a cost-effective means forreducing diesel fuel. 414 m square (4456 ft2)
of solar cladding were installed on the southfacing roof.
The heat from the panels is ducted down intothe burner, yielding a nominal air flow of 60m3/h/m2 and preheating the air entering thedryer by 20 C.
It displaces about 14% of the heating fuel,
yielding a 2 year payback.
